Page 3 Figure 1. There is a metal cover with one screw you remove to see the burner. THAT screw is labeled in that pic. Have someone push the inside Safety button and then someone outside lights the flame. Doug
PS, on this model it takes 2 people. Now, on the back of the refer you will see a slot in the gas valve to manually turn the gas inlet valve OFF. So, to SAFELY do the lighting by yourself, you would turn the gas valve OFF at the back(not the selector switch inside). The slot is horizontal now(open) Turn it vertically will shut it OFF. Once OFF you make sure the inside selector switch is ON LP. Then get some type of wedge like a toothpick or something to HOLD the Safety valve push button IN. Go outside and turn the gas valve ON and then light the burner. Then go back inside and MAKE SURE YOU REMOVE THE WEDGE KEEPING THAT SAFETY VALVE PUSHED IN. MAKE SURE YOU REMOVE THAT SAFETY VALVE WEDGE TOOL!!!!!!!!!!!. The flame will stay on. You can purchase an after market electric Piezo kit to fabricate a way to light the refer in the future.
